Hawthorne James, born in Chicago, Illinois, is an American actor known for his dynamic performances in cult cinema. He appears in Disco Godfather (1979), where he embodies the vibrant energy of the disco era, and Penitentiary II (1982), a gritty exploration of life behind bars. His role in Patty Hearst (1988) further highlights his range as an actor. Penitentiary II
Martel "Too Sweet" Gordone earned his parole from jail by winning a prison boxing tournament. All Too Sweet wants to do is start a peaceful life, but a condition of his release is that he work for a boxing promoter. Too Sweet has no interest in boxing and wants to live with his sister and her husband who support his desire to start over. However, when an old enemy from prison, Half Dead, escapes and kills his girlfriend, Too Sweet changes his plans and returns to the ring.
